UC Irvine visits Hawaii following Welp’s 30-point game

UC Irvine Anteaters (6-4, 1-0 Big West) at Hawaii Rainbow Warriors (5-5, 1-0 Big West)

Honolulu; Friday, 12 a.m. EST

FANDUEL SPORTSBOOK LINE: Hawaii -6.5; over/under is 132.5

BOTTOM LINE: UC Irvine plays the Hawaii Rainbow Warriors after Collin Welp scored 30 points in UC Irvine’s 68-51 victory against the UC Riverside Highlanders.

The Rainbow Warriors have gone 3-2 in home games. Hawaii is second in the Big West with 13.9 assists per game led by JoVon McClanahan averaging 3.9.

The Anteaters are 1-0 against Big West opponents. UC Irvine is seventh in the Big West scoring 68.4 points per game and is shooting 44.3%.

The Rainbow Warriors and Anteaters square off Friday for the first time in Big West play this season.

TOP PERFORMERS: Noel Coleman is scoring 18.5 points per game with 2.3 rebounds and 1.8 assists for the Rainbow Warriors. Jerome Desrosiers is averaging 11.1 points and 7.7 rebounds while shooting 47.1% for Hawaii.

Welp is shooting 42.3% and averaging 15.4 points for the Anteaters. JC Butler is averaging 7.4 points for UC Irvine.
